The Stifterverband für die Deutsche Wissenschaft is a not-for-profit registered association, headquartered in Essen. His fields of work are education, science and innovation. [1] It has set itself the task of recognizing and solving structural problems in the field of science and academia. In addition, the Stifterverband with the German Foundation Center is a trustee for currently around 650 mostly scientific foundations. [2] The Founders' Association was founded in 1920. In addition to his headquarters in Essen, he runs an office in Berlin. The President has been Andreas Barner since 2013. He follows the Berlin entrepreneur Arend Oetker, who has held this office since 1998. Since February 2005, Andreas Schlüter has been the general secretary of the Stifterverband für die Deutsche Wissenschaft.
The Donors' Association is funded primarily by donations from its approximately 3,000 members; Its main sponsors are a number of large corporations such as Deutsche Bank, Daimler and Bosch, but also SMEs and private individuals. In 2015, the Stifterverband invested 34.7 million euros in its funding programs. [3] The largest single item was 11.6 million euros for foundations at universities and technical colleges.
